How Rates Functions Behind the Curtain
Three layers shape your complete cost: dealer costs, IRA administration, and storage and delivery. Gold and silver Individual retirement accounts typically entail an one-time arrangement fee, an annual maintenance cost, and an annual storage cost. The dealer gains a spread between the wholesale cost and what you pay. That spread varies by product. Usual bullion coins like American Gold Eagles or Gold Maples tend to lug lower costs than specialized or proof coins. Silver items typically have higher portion markups than gold due to the fact that taken care of costs impend larger relative to the reduced steel price.
A sensible premium setting for widely traded bullion may be in the series of 3 to 10 percent over place for gold and 8 to 20 percent for silver, varying with market anxiety. Dealers can price quote higher rates for "special" inventory or evidence coins, often surpassing those ranges. In some goldco testimonials, consumers really felt surprised when they discovered how much of their initial acquisition mosted likely to premium. That does not make the pricing incorrect, yet it highlights the demand to ask for a line-item quote: spot cost, supplier premium, any type of commission, and shipping and insurance.
Storage costs for set apart storage - where your details bars and coins are kept separately - generally run greater than non-segregated or commingled storage space. Investors who want serial-number coverage favor segregated. Others like to reduce the annual price. Custodian administrative fees tend to be level, not linked to account worth, which prefers bigger accounts. For a $10,000 appropriation, a $200 annual cost hits more difficult than for a $150,000 allocation.

A Go through the Refine, Step by Step
Even if Goldco takes care of the research, it aids to know what is taking place. You begin by opening up a self-directed individual retirement account with a partner custodian. This is a separate account from your common broker agent IRA. After that you fund the account with a rollover or transfer. Your cash money rests with the custodian till you position a steels order via Goldco. Once you approve the quote, the dealership sends the steels to a certified vault, not to your home. The custodian documents the possessions on your IRA declaration. You get routine statements and commonly a storage confirmation.
If you ever before want to take an in-kind distribution, the custodian can ship the steels to you. That activates tax obligations if it is a typical individual retirement account distribution, equally as taking cash would certainly. Alternatively, you can ask the dealership to buy back the steels and have the custodian send out cash money profits. Timelines vary from a couple of days to a number of weeks, relying on shipping and inner processing.

The Cost Photo, Unbundled
You will certainly experience three pails of costs:
- Dealer expenses: costs over place, sometimes delivering and insurance policy. These are embedded in the quote and vary by product and market conditions.
- Custodian prices: single configuration costs and yearly upkeep. These are published by the custodian. Apartment charges prefer larger balances.
- Storage prices: annual rising, segregated or non-segregated. Set apart costs much more however supplies more clear property tracking.
To set expectations, request all-in costs over 5 years based on your planned allotment and liked items. If you mean to buy $50,000 of gold and silver, map the yearly storage space and admin costs against that base and contrast those to your anticipated holding period. If you intend to hold for a decade, an added 2 percent up front may be less considerable than a high yearly charge. If you plan to market within two years, the opposite is true.
Where the "Hidden Fees" Grievances Come From
Most supposed covert costs are either baked into the premium or rest outside the supplier's invoice. As an example, the custodian may bill a cord fee or special delivery charge. The depository could apply a tiny fee for set apart supply adjustments. These do not constantly show up in marketing products due to the fact that the dealer does not manage them. The option is to ask for a written recap from all events. Ask the custodian for its cost schedule and the depository for its storage tiers. If any type of rep withstands, treat it as a yellow flag as opposed to a red one and demand documentation.
Another frequent disappointment includes "free silver" promos. Some offers credit report a portion of your acquisition with bonus metals if you invest over a threshold. The incentive has a value, yet the deal structure can bring about product combines with greater markups that subsidize the promotion. If you like the bargain, fine, however compare the reliable price per ounce across the entire order, bonus offer consisted of, to a straightforward bullion acquisition without the promotion.
Buyback Policies and Liquidity
Goldco advertises a buyback program, which reduces a typical concern: going out. The actual inquiries are the spread and logistics. Dealers usually estimate buyback prices linked to the spot bid minus a tiny price cut. If your initial costs was high, the spread on the way out can sting. That does not make the program negative, yet it tells you to match item type to your departure expectations. Simple bullion coins and bars generally have tighter spreads in both directions than evidence or limited editions.
Liquidity additionally depends upon product experience. Major vaults and suppliers can relocate American Eagles, Maples, and bars from acknowledged refiners swiftly. If you buy something specific niche, resale may take longer or need a steeper discount. When I suggest customers, I prefer less complex, much more fluid products for IRA holdings and get collectible impulses, if any, for taxed accounts where you can hold and display without IRS restrictions.

Tax and Conformity Nuances Worth Knowing
The IRS rules right here are stringent yet workable. Gold needs to be 99.5 percent pure, silver 99.9 percent, with certain coins like American Eagles carved out explicitly as appropriate. You can not store individual retirement account steels in your home or in a risk-free down payment box you regulate. That is the custodian and depository's role. Taking possession counts as a distribution, taxable in a conventional IRA, and possibly based on fines if you are under the qualified age. Goldco comprehends these rules and guides clients accordingly, which helps maintain your account compliant.
If you plan a Roth conversion, do it prior to purchasing metals so you prevent evaluation peculiarities. Conversions need fair market value reporting. It is less complicated to transform money than to assess numerous coin SKUs for the conversion point.
Sizing the Allocation
No review break down is total without the profile question. For many varied capitalists, an appropriation between 2 and 10 percent to physical steels covers the mental and diversification objectives without dominating the tax-advantaged space or charge drag. Above that degree, costs and possibility price rise. I have seen clients press higher allocations during situations, then trim when markets normalize. If you are utilizing an individual retirement account, bear in mind that metals do not throw off earnings. You are paying yearly fees for an asset that does not intensify via returns. The return vehicle driver is price gratitude or currency hedge advantages. That is great, yet it ought to be intentional.
